Finance Review — Harwick Lane Lease Renegotiation. We concluded talks with Bellmore Estates on the Harwick Lane warehouse. Annual rent drops 9% in exchange for a five-year extension and our assuming minor maintenance costs. Net savings over the term are estimated at a mid six-figure sum, improving Q3 facilities spend. Termination penalties remain unchanged. The renegotiated terms connect directly to our wider plans below.

confidential, kagup-bafog: Fraaxax Group is in early talks to buy Soroxox Group for about $343.8 million. The Olidor launch date is June 14, and nothing goes to the press before then. Legal wants the Aldmirek Logistics term sheet signed before July 23.

Subject: Handover — Liftwise dispatch simulator DB

Hi Rowan,

Welcome to the Liftwise project. The elevator-dispatch simulator writes every simulated car movement to the `dispatch_runs` schema, so the tables grow quickly — the nightly pruning job keeps only the last thirty days. Please review the pruning cron before changing any retention settings, and never run simulations against the analytics replica.

For your local setup, configure the simulator with the connection string below.

Best,
Celia

primary connection of yagep-kahip = redis://giliel_svc:zYiKsLL2PLpfPL@db-348f.xolmarsys.corp:5432/fenwyn

Ticket: RESTOCK-PLANNER — expired credential blocking nightly plan

Priority: High

The SnackRoute restock planner failed its 02:00 run because the credential it uses to pull machine inventory from the StockFeed service expired yesterday. No plans were generated, so field techs have stale routes this morning. I have provisioned a replacement key with identical scopes; please include it in tonight's release config. The new StockFeed key follows.

gateway credential: kto23_LX9A4ys6i4nzHtpOLNLodKK